Title:
ALTERNATE COMBUSTION TYPE REGENERATIVE RADIANT TUBE BURNER SYSTEM

Abstract:
PROBLEM TO BE SOLVED: To reduce a pressure loss during the exhaustion while enabling use of a regenerative body in a wider range. SOLUTION: An injection hole forming means 6 which separates an air throat 2 internally equipped with a regenerative body 4 and a combustion space 8 in a radiant tube is provided with an injection hole 3 which has the surface 7 thereof made spherical facing the side of the combustion space 8 on the side of the radiant tube and the surface 9 thereof made hemispherical facing the side of the air throat 2 as plane orthogonal to the inner circumferential surface 1a of the radiant tube 1 while arranged so biased to inscribe or in proximity to the inner circumferential surface 1a of the radiant tube 1 and a clearance 10 is made between the hole and the inner circumferential surface 1a of the radiant tube 1. During the combustion period with a burner, air for combustion is injected mainly through the injection hole 3 and during the stoppage of the combustion, an exhaust gas is made to flow into the air throat 2 not only from the injection hole 3 but also from the clearance 10 between the hole and the radiant tube 1 on the perimeter of the injection hole forming means 6.
